Draft Mechanic Episode #71: One Deck Dungeon (six-pack review & on-tap); Mystery of the Temples preview; Hardback; Pitch Deck; SMaSH beer & Soloable Games
Dungeons! They’re everywhere these days, right? Always opportunities to delve for treasure, so what makes One Deck Dungeon unique? We’ll find out today in our Six-Pack review of this rogue-like, pocket sized dungeon delving card game. If temples are more your thing, we’ve got a preview of Mystery of the Temples (hitting Kickstarter this week!). And then there’s Hardback, a deck builder of letters, and Pitch Deck, a company pitching game of tropes. We round this one up by explaining what SMaSH means in the beer world (no crushing is involved) and we ask the Slack about what makes a game great for solo play.
